The backbone of robotic perception lies in several core technologies that enable machines to perceive their environment effectively. One of the foundational technologies is computer vision, which allows robots to interpret visual information from cameras and sensors. Utilizing machine learning algorithms, especially deep learning, robots can be trained to recognize and classify objects with high accuracy. Another crucial technology is sensor fusion, which involves combining data from multiple sensors (like lidar, radar, and ultrasonic sensors) to create a comprehensive understanding of the environment. This capability is essential for tasks such as navigation, where the robot must accurately gauge distances and recognize obstacles. Furthermore, natural language processing (NLP) plays a role in enabling robots to understand and interact with human commands, facilitating seamless communication. Together, these technologies create a robust framework for robotic perception, empowering robots to adapt to diverse challenges and environments.
Computer vision has become an integral component of robotic perception, particularly in enabling robots to identify and interact with objects in their surroundings. This technology relies on sophisticated algorithms and models that process images and video data to detect and classify various elements within a scene. Using convolutional neural networks (CNNs), robots can effectively analyze visual data, allowing them to distinguish between different objects, recognize patterns, and even infer the nature of interactions needed. The advancements in this field have led to significant improvements in applications such as autonomous driving, where vehicles must analyze their surroundings in real-time to navigate safely. Moreover, as deep learning techniques continue to evolve, the accuracy and efficiency of object recognition systems are expected to improve, further enhancing robotic capabilities.
Sensor fusion is essential for accurate and reliable robotic perception, as it aggregates data from various sensors to build a unified representation of the robot's environment. This process typically involves algorithms that combine different types of sensor data, such as distance measurements from lidar and visual data from cameras, to create a more holistic view of the surroundings. The fusion of sensory data not only improves the precision of environmental perception but also helps robots navigate in complex scenarios where singular sensor data may be lacking or misleading. For instance, in challenging weather conditions, visual sensors may struggle, while radar can provide vital information. By leveraging sensor fusion techniques, robots can enhance their situational awareness, leading to more effective decision-making and safer operations.
Natural language processing (NLP) plays a pivotal role in bridging the communication gap between humans and robots, making human-robot interaction more intuitive. Through NLP, robots can understand spoken or written commands and respond appropriately, fostering a more collaborative environment. This technology typically involves processing user inputs to extract intent and context, enabling robots to carry out tasks based on natural language instructions. Applications of NLP in robotics range from personal assistant robots that manage household chores to industrial robots that require precise control based on employee commands. As advancements in NLP continue to develop, the potential for robots to understand complex queries and context could lead to more sophisticated and autonomous interactions.
While AI has greatly advanced robotic perception, several challenges persist that researchers and developers must address to improve functionality and safety. One prevalent issue is the variability of environmental conditions. Robots often operate in dynamic settings where lighting conditions, weather, and obstacles can change unexpectedly. These fluctuations can affect sensor accuracy and, consequently, a robot's ability to interpret its surroundings reliably. Additionally, the complexity of human environments presents another challenge; for instance, cluttered spaces can confuse object recognition systems if not properly trained. Another challenge is the ethical implications surrounding autonomous robots. As robots become more integrated into daily life, questions about data security, privacy, and decision-making processes are paramount. Ensuring these systems operate transparently and ethically will be essential in gaining public trust and wider acceptance.
The adaptability of robots to varying environmental conditions is crucial for their perception capabilities. Environmental factors like lighting, weather, and even the physical arrangement of objects can significantly influence sensor performance. For example, a robot equipped with cameras may struggle to identify objects in low-light conditions or glare. This variability necessitates that robotic systems employ advanced algorithms capable of adapting to such changes. Research in this area is focused on developing models that help robots learn from diverse datasets, improving their ability to generalize from known conditions to unfamiliar situations. This adaptation is essential for ensuring robot functionality in real-world applications where unpredictability is the norm.
Human environments are inherently complex, filled with dynamic elements that can challenge robotic perception systems. In a typical home or workspace, objects can be displaced or obscured, requiring robots to maintain a high level of spatial awareness and adaptability. Developing robust algorithms to handle clutter, occlusion, and overlapping objects is vital. Furthermore, as robots are expected to collaborate with human users, they must possess the ability to interpret social cues and understand human intentions. This adds an additional layer of complexity to robotic perception that researchers are actively exploring, emphasizing the need for continuous advancements in technology to keep pace with the intricate nature of human environments.
As robots become more autonomous and integrated into society, ethical considerations surrounding their operation and decision-making processes become increasingly crucial. The ability of a robot to perceive and respond to its environment raises questions regarding data privacy, consent, and accountability. For instance, if a robot encounters a situation requiring a moral decision, it may rely on programmed algorithms that lack a nuanced understanding of ethics. Additionally, the vast amounts of data required for effective robotic perception further heighten concerns about data security and user privacy. As robotics technology continues to evolve, establishing clear ethical guidelines and standards will be essential to ensure responsible development and deployment, addressing public concerns and fostering trust in robotic systems.
This section aims to address common queries regarding how artificial intelligence improves the perceptual capabilities of robots. Delve into the complexities of robotic perception and discover how AI synergizes with robotics to enhance their functionality and efficiency.
Robotic perception refers to the ability of robots to interpret and understand sensory information from their environment. In the context of AI, this involves utilizing algorithms that process data from various sensors—like cameras and LIDAR—enabling robots to recognize objects, navigate spaces, and interact with their surroundings effectively.
AI enhances robotic perception by enabling advanced data processing capabilities. Machine learning and computer vision algorithms allow robots to learn from vast amounts of data, improving their ability to identify patterns, make decisions, and adapt to new situations in real-time, thereby increasing their operational efficiency and reliability.
Key technologies involved in robotic perception include artificial intelligence algorithms, machine learning models, computer vision systems, and sensor technologies such as cameras, LIDAR, and ultrasonic sensors. These components work together to give robots the ability to sense and interpret their environment accurately, facilitating smarter interactions.
Robotic perception AI has a wide range of applications including autonomous vehicles, manufacturing robots, drone navigation, and robotic assistants in healthcare. In each of these areas, enhanced perception allows robots to perform tasks more safely and effectively, improving productivity and user experience.
Robots face several challenges regarding perception, such as sensor limitations, environmental variability, and the need for real-time processing. Adapting to unpredictable conditions and ensuring accurate recognition of objects in different contexts can also be significant hurdles for robotic systems, necessitating ongoing advancements in AI and machine learning.